#0db824 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0db824 is composed of 5.1% red, 72.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 38.6%. #0db824 color hex could be obtained by blending #1aff48 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#0db824 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0db824 has RGB values of R:13, G:184,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 899108.

Shades and Tints of #0db824
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0db824
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606561 is the less saturated color, while #05c01e is the most saturated one.
